M

azure-storage-queue-ts

von microsoft

azure-storage-queue-ts ist ein praxisnahes Skill für Azure Queue Storage in TypeScript und JavaScript. Es hilft Backend-Entwicklern dabei, Warteschlangen-Nachrichten mit der passenden Authentifizierung, dem richtigen Setup der Umgebung und den passenden Client-Typen zu senden, zu empfangen, vorab anzuzeigen und zu löschen. Verwenden Sie es als fokussierten Leitfaden für azure-storage-queue-ts, um zuverlässige Message-Queue-Operationen umzusetzen.

Stars2.3k
Favoriten0
Kommentare0
Hinzugefügt8. Mai 2026
KategorieBackend Development
Installationsbefehl
npx skills add microsoft/skills --skill azure-storage-queue-ts
Kurationswert

Dieses Skill erreicht 78/100 und ist damit ein solider Kandidat für das Verzeichnis: Nutzer erhalten einen klar auslösbaren Azure-Queue-Storage-Workflow mit genug operativer Tiefe, um die Installation zu rechtfertigen, auch wenn der Eintrag auf einige dünn besetzte Begleitmaterialien hinweisen sollte. Das Repository liefert Agenten ein gutes Signal dafür, wann es eingesetzt werden sollte und was es leisten kann, und ist damit hilfreicher als ein generischer Prompt für Warteschlangenaufgaben.

78/100
Stärken
  • Starke Auslösbarkeit: Das Frontmatter nennt Azure Queue Storage ausdrücklich und enthält konkrete Trigger wie "queue storage", "QueueServiceClient", "QueueClient" und "send message".
  • Klarer operativer Umfang: Der Skill-Text behandelt Senden, Empfangen, Vorab-Anzeigen, Löschen, Visibility Timeout, Message Encoding und Batch-Operationen.
  • Installationsbereite Grundlagen sind vorhanden: Es gibt Hinweise zu npm install, Node.js-Version, Umgebungsvariablen und Authentifizierungsbeispiele für den Zugriff auf Azure.
Hinweise
  • Die Begleitdateien sind spärlich: Es gibt keine Scripts, References, Resources, Rules, Assets oder README-Dateien, sodass sich Nutzer fast vollständig auf SKILL.md verlassen müssen.
  • Die Metadaten in der Beschreibung sind knapp, und die Repository-Hinweise zeigen außerhalb des Haupt-Markdowns nur wenig Workflow-Signal. Für Sonderfälle kann daher zusätzliches Prompting nötig sein.
Überblick

Überblick über azure-storage-queue-ts

azure-storage-queue-ts ist eine praktische Skill für die Nutzung des Azure Queue Storage TypeScript SDK, @azure/storage-queue, wenn Sie in Node.js zuverlässige Message-Queue-Operationen brauchen. Sie eignet sich besonders für Backend-Entwickler, die Queue-Nachrichten senden, empfangen, vorab prüfen und löschen möchten, ohne bei Authentifizierung, Umgebungseinrichtung oder den richtigen Client-Typen zu raten.

Wofür diese Skill gedacht ist

Die Skill azure-storage-queue-ts passt zu echten Queue-Workflows: Services entkoppeln, Hintergrundjobs puffern, Worker-Prozesse aufbauen und nachträglich verarbeitbare Nachrichten behandeln. Am nützlichsten ist sie, wenn Sie einen fokussierten azure-storage-queue-ts guide brauchen, der Sie von „Ich brauche eine Queue-Lösung“ zu lauffähigem Code bringt.

Was vor der Installation am wichtigsten ist

Der wichtigste Entscheidungsfaktor ist die Authentifizierung. Diese Skill setzt auf Microsoft Entra Token-basierte Authentifizierung als empfohlenen Weg, unterstützt aber weiterhin Account-Key- oder Connection-String-Muster. Wenn Ihre App in Azure läuft, Managed Identity nutzt oder bereits auf @azure/identity aufbaut, ist die azure-storage-queue-ts skill eine sehr gute Wahl.

Wann sie gut passt

Nutzen Sie azure-storage-queue-ts für die Backend-Entwicklung, wenn Ihre Aufgabe Queue-I/O ist und nicht die breitere Azure-Architektur. Sie ist eine gute Wahl für Services, die Kontrolle über die Visibility Timeout, Verständnis für Message-Encoding und Batch-Operationen brauchen. Wenn Sie nur einen einmaligen Prompt wollen, der „Queues erklärt“, ist diese Skill wahrscheinlich mehr, als Sie benötigen.

So verwenden Sie die azure-storage-queue-ts skill

Paketinstallierung durchführen und die Paketbasis prüfen

Für azure-storage-queue-ts install installieren Sie das SDK-Paket und das Identity-Paket:

npm install @azure/storage-queue @azure/identity

Stellen Sie sicher, dass Ihre Laufzeit die Node.js-18+-Anforderung erfüllt, bevor Sie die Skill in ein Projekt einbinden. Wenn Sie einen anderen Package Manager verwenden, installieren Sie dieselben Abhängigkeiten über Ihren gewohnten Workflow.

Zuerst die richtigen Dateien lesen

Beginnen Sie mit SKILL.md und lesen Sie dann die Abschnitte zu Installation, Umgebungsvariablen und Authentifizierung, bevor Sie Code schreiben. Wenn Sie die Skill in ein anderes Repo übernehmen, prüfen Sie die vorhandenen Credential-Helper und Konfigurationskonventionen Ihrer App, damit Sie die Verbindungsverwaltung nicht doppelt bauen.

Der Skill sollte eine vollständige Aufgabenbeschreibung bekommen

Die besten Anfragen zur azure-storage-queue-ts usage enthalten Queue-Name, Laufzeitumgebung, Auth-Methode und die genaue Operation, die Sie brauchen. Fragen Sie zum Beispiel so statt mit einem vagen „hilf mir mit Queues“:

  • „Erstelle einen Node.js-Worker, der Nachrichten aus orders empfängt, verarbeitet und sie erst nach Erfolg löscht.“
  • „Zeige, wie man mit QueueClient und Managed Identity Batch-Nachrichten an eine Azure Storage Queue sendet.“
  • „Passe das für lokale Entwicklung mit DefaultAzureCredential und Produktion mit Managed Identity an.“

Den Workflow nutzen, für den die Skill gebaut wurde

Ein starker azure-storage-queue-ts guide-Ablauf ist: Authentifizierung wählen, Umgebungsvariablen setzen, einen QueueServiceClient oder QueueClient erstellen, das Sende-/Empfangsverhalten testen und danach Visibility Timeout sowie Löschlogik ergänzen. Diese Reihenfolge ist wichtig, weil Queue-Fehler oft durch Auth- oder Message-Lifecycle-Fehler entstehen und nicht durch den eigentlichen Basis-API-Aufruf.

Häufige Fragen zur azure-storage-queue-ts skill

Ist azure-storage-queue-ts nur für Azure-gehostete Apps gedacht?

Nein. Die azure-storage-queue-ts skill funktioniert für lokale Entwicklung, Azure-gehostete Services und hybride Setups. Die wichtigste Voraussetzung ist, dass Ihr Code Azure-Anmeldedaten in einer Form abrufen kann, die zu Ihrer Umgebung passt.

Brauche ich @azure/identity auch?

Meistens ja, vor allem wenn Sie den empfohlenen Microsoft-Entra-Ansatz nutzen möchten. Die Skill kombiniert @azure/storage-queue ausdrücklich mit @azure/identity, damit Sie Keys möglichst nicht hart codieren müssen.

Ist das besser als ein generischer Prompt zu Queues?

Ja, wenn Sie korrekte SDK-Nutzung, Umgebungsvariablen und Auth-Entscheidungen brauchen. Ein generischer Prompt kann Queue-Konzepte erklären, aber azure-storage-queue-ts ist auf lauffähigen TypeScript-Code und weniger Integrationsfehler ausgerichtet.

Wann sollte ich diese Skill nicht verwenden?

Verwenden Sie sie nicht, wenn Sie gar nicht mit Azure Queue Storage arbeiten oder Ihr Problem eher architektonisch als SDK-spezifisch ist. Wenn Sie RabbitMQ, SQS oder eine andere Sprache als TypeScript/JavaScript brauchen, ist diese Skill nicht die richtige Wahl.

So verbessern Sie die azure-storage-queue-ts skill

Beginnen Sie mit dem genauen Queue-Verhalten, das Sie brauchen

Der schnellste Weg zu besseren Ergebnissen ist, den Nachrichten-Lifecycle präzise zu benennen. Sagen Sie, ob Sie nur senden, empfangen und löschen, nur vorab prüfen, verzögertes Sichtbarkeitsverhalten oder Batch-Verarbeitung brauchen. Bei azure-storage-queue-ts ändern diese Entscheidungen die Code-Struktur und die Fehlerbehandlung.

Geben Sie Auth- und Bereitstellungskontext direkt mit

Sagen Sie dem Modell, ob Sie Account Keys, einen Connection String, DefaultAzureCredential oder Managed Identity verwenden. Nennen Sie auch den Ausführungsort: lokaler Laptop, Container, App Service, AKS oder ein anderer Azure-Host. Das ist der größte Hebel für die Qualität der azure-storage-queue-ts skill.

Fordern Sie Code an, der zu Ihren betrieblichen Vorgaben passt

Wenn Ihnen Idempotenz, Retries, Poison-Message-Handling oder Message-Encoding wichtig sind, nennen Sie diese Anforderungen ausdrücklich. Zum Beispiel: „Gib mir einen Worker zurück, der Fehler protokolliert, das Visibility Timeout respektiert und die Nachrichtenverarbeitung idempotent hält.“ So hat die Skill genug Details, um Ausgaben zu erzeugen, die Sie tatsächlich ausliefern können.

Iterieren Sie, indem Sie eine Ebene nach der anderen verengen

Wenn die erste Antwort zu breit ist, präzisieren Sie mit Queue-Größe, Durchsatz oder Parallelitätsanforderungen. Wenn sie zu niedrig aufgelöst ist, bitten Sie um eine Implementierung plus ein minimales Konfigurationsbeispiel. Die beste azure-storage-queue-ts usage entsteht, wenn Sie die erste Antwort als Entwurf behandeln und dann auf Ihre realen Produktionsbedingungen zuschneiden.

Bewertungen & Rezensionen

Noch keine Bewertungen
Teile deine Rezension
Melde dich an, um für diesen Skill eine Bewertung und einen Kommentar zu hinterlassen.
G
0/10000
Neueste Rezensionen
Wird gespeichert...